Silvan (born 18 May 1937) is an Italian illusionist, writer and television personality.

He gained mainstream popularity in 1973 hosting the RAI Saturday night magic and illusionism show ''Sim Salabim''.
After six decades as a magician, Silvan continues to perform on television and touring his full evening show.

Silvan has written several books, appeared in some films
(notably, as "The great Pacco", in ''Modesty Blaise'',1966) and has collaborated with a number of publications. He is an honorary member of CICAP, a skeptic scientific organization.
He considers himself Roman Catholic.
